Kilojoule to Foot-pound Converter
One Kilojoule equals 737.5621493 Foot-pound (1 kJ = 737.5621493 ft-lb). Multiply a Kilojoule value by 737.5621493 to get the equivalent in Foot-pound. Use the calculator above for instant results, or follow the formula, worked examples, and reference table below.
Formula
ft-lb = kJ × 737.5621493
Multiply the Kilojoule value by 737.5621493 to get the equivalent value in Foot-pound.

About Kilojoule and Foot-pound
The kilojoule is 1,000 joules. Food energy in Australia, Europe, and most metric countries is labeled in kilojoules alongside or instead of calories. The foot-pound is about 1.3558 joules — the work of one pound-force through one foot. US mechanical engineering and firearm muzzle energy use foot-pounds. One Kilojoule equals 737.5621493 Foot-pound (1 kJ = 737.5621493 ft-lb). Kilojoule to Foot-pound conversion comes up most often in food labels outside the US and in exercise energy expenditure, typically when figures need restating for US mechanical engineering.
Precision and Rounding: Energy factors mix exact definitions (1 kWh = 3,600,000 J; 1 cal = 4.184 J thermochemical) with measured conventions (1 BTU ≈ 1,055.056 J). Nutrition and utility bills round to whole units; engineering heat calculations should keep the full factor until the final step.
